mysqlclient是一个 C 语言编写的 MySQL 数据库驱动,它继承自MySQL-python,功能强大且性能优越。由于其底层使用 C 语言,mysqlclient通常能够提供更快的性能。要使用它,你需要先安装 MySQL 数据库的开发库。 pymysql pymysql是一个纯 Python 编写的数据库驱动,它的使用相对简单且易于安装。即使没有 C
mysql.my_execute(sql, values)# mysql.cursor.execute(sql, values)# 更新方法 update User(传关键字参数) ---》 user_obj.orm_insert(user_obj)deform_update(self): mysql = MySQLClient()# 字段名keys = []# 字段值values = []# 主键: id=pkprimary_key =Nonefork, vinself.mappings.items():if...
但是我们在开发阶段使用pymysql,上线的时候仍然需要使用mysqlclient这导致了本地开发环境的依赖和上线环境依赖不一样在每个项目中都有requirements.txt文件,用于指明所有依赖和版本在项目中,我们在cmd中使用下方命令可以查看当前使用的环境和依赖 pip freeze 显示当前环境装的所有依赖...
https://github.com/PyMySQL/PyMySQL 二个库的作者是同一个人。 pymysql: pure python mysql client mysqlclient: mysql database connector for python( with python3 support)